Graduate Research Fellow (GAAN)
The Graduate Research (GAAN) Fellow position in Biology is responsible for graduate student research leading to an M.S. (thesis track) in Environmental and Biological Sciences at Troy University, including all expectations of professional development, mentorship, and activities required by the GAAN grant funded by the Department of Education.
Minimum Qualifications:
- Academic Achievement:
Bachelor's degree in Biological Sciences or a related field. Minimum GPA of 3.3 from the previous degree (BS or MS). - Financial Need:
Demonstration of financial need, as determined by the Financial Aid Office, and eligibility to receive federal assistance. - Citizenship or Residency:
Must be a U.S. citizen, permanent resident, or a resident of a Freely Associated State. - Commitment to Research and Teaching:
Strong interest in pursuing advanced research and teaching in the biological sciences. Desire to pursue a Ph.D. in biological sciences or a related field upon completion of the master's program. - Professional Potential:
Demonstrated potential through letters of recommendation, a statement of purpose, or previous research experience.
Preferred Qualifications:
- Strong communication skills showing both oral and written proficiency.
- Strong quantitative skills.

List any hazardous conditions or physical demands required by this position:
This position involves potential exposure to hazardous chemicals, biological agents, and sharp instruments in the lab, as well as environmental risks such as extreme weather and uneven terrain during fieldwork. Physical demands include extended periods of standing, repetitive motions, lifting up to 25 pounds, and travel to field sites. Proper safety training, equipment, and protocols will be provided to mitigate these risks.
